Who did we survey for this report?
The survey collected responses between the 2nd March and 8th March. In total, there were 313 survey participants in the United Kingdom. Respondents had to service business clients to be eligible to participate in the research.
Job titles of respondents include accountants, business owners, CEOs, CFOs, payroll professionals and bookkeepers. Business types include accountancy, consultancy, HR, payroll bureaus and bookkeeping firms.
